    The building is empty, but luminescent crystal signs give precise directions, which Gunstar Hero ignores (but happens coincidentally to follow) as the Story leads him to the hangar, his retinue of sidekicks following behind him. Speakers in the main building constantly repeated variants of the same warnings that had echoed in the compartment.

    "Warning. An Apostate has been spotted in the building. The Void Hunt has been alerted. Please evacuate the building."

    Three voices can be heard, echoing some distance into the building. Two of them are uncomfortably familiar; the tones and patterns of speech of the two guards when at last they spoke, repeated in alien mouths. The third is a mechanical scream like a swarm of angry bees, and it carries by far the furthest.

    "- And I'll rend your innards and split your gizzard, toast your nose on a spit and chop your ugly spleen into smaller spleen-shaped pieces! Now open up!"

    "Why should he do that if you're just going to kill him?" The voice was female, the speaker absolutely calm, asking the question with academic detatchment. "Would you remove your armor for someone trying to kill you?"

    The bee voice hesitated. ""I'll keep on killing the hostages until you open up!"

    Team Hero is getting closer and closer to the Kairemer's hangar...

    The last voice is sensible and fatherly. "Be a little more patient, son; Haste makes waste and you don't need to be so prodigal. Torture them first. There's a very simple method that always gets results that I'd be glad to teach you..."

    Gunstar Hero is at the high door that connects to the hangar; the rest of the party following on his heels.

    "No more delays! Stop ambassing that door and start helping me kill these hostages!"
